Description
HOPE is a non-profit, non-partisan, organization committed to ensuring political and economic parity for Latinas through leadership, advocacy and education.

Program areas at HOPE

Leadership - statewide leadership programs incorporating experiential learning, personal, and group skill development and fellowship among participants focusing on the interrelated issues of health, economic development and education.
Youth & college leadership - a statewide development program designed to prepare low-income, high school-age latinas for a self-sufficient future that will allow for economic and Political parity through a college education.
Latina history day - a conference that gathers latinas to celebrate history and empowers women through workshops and other activities.
State of latinas - is a series of publications that details facts and figures highlighting the status of how latinas are faring in the united states. The publications are used by the public to measure what type of program or policies are working to support the advancement of latinas.
Latina action day - policy and advocacy conference designed to educate latinas on the Political process through workshops and experimental training.
Binational fellowship - a program for outstanding latina executives from the united states and mexico to catapult their leadership onto the national and global stage.
